A press brake for shipbuilding comes equipped with several vital functions that streamline production processes. Firstly, its ability to bend metal sheets of various thicknesses makes it versatile. This versatility allows shipbuilders to create complex shapes and structures needed for hulls, decks, and other components. Furthermore, advanced press brakes often integrate Computer Numerical Control (CNC) technology, enabling automated and highly precise bending, which reduces human error and improves overall quality. The capability of executing multiple bends in a single setup further maximizes efficiency, reducing cycle times significantly.
While the advantages are significant, there are also considerations to keep in mind. One of the key benefits of a press brake for shipbuilding is its ability to enhance productivity. The precision achieved means less material waste and rework, leading to cost savings in the long run. Additionally, the automation features of modern press brakes can reduce labor costs, as fewer personnel are required to operate the equipment.
On the downside, the initial investment for quality press brakes can be substantial. High-end models equipped with advanced features may have higher upfront costs, which could be a concern for smaller shipyards. Maintenance and training requirements also need to be considered, as personnel must be adequately trained to operate sophisticated machinery safely. Moreover, while CNC technology offers precision, it may also require specialized skills for programming and troubleshooting.

Price-wise, a press brake can range from several thousand to tens of thousands of dollars, depending on the model, brand, and features. Investing in a higher-quality version may seem steep initially, but the long-term cost savings through efficiency improvements and reduced waste can justify the expense. It’s crucial for shipbuilders to conduct a thorough cost-benefit analysis to determine the best match for their needs.
